The Role of Intrinsic Motivation and Autonomy (Self-Determination Theory)

Self-Determination Theory (SDT), developed by psychologists Edward Deci and Richard Ryan, posits that humans have three fundamental psychological needs:

  1. Autonomy – the need to feel in control of one’s actions
  2. Competence – the need to feel capable and effective
  3. Relatedness – the need to feel connected and supported

When these needs are satisfied, intrinsic motivation flourishes.

Traditional teaching often undermines these:

  • Rigid curriculums erode autonomy
  • One-size-fits-all evaluation weakens perceived competence
  • Authoritative instruction disconnects learners from peers and mentors

In contrast, coaching and self-learning fuel autonomy by inviting choice, responsibility, and goal-setting. Learners are no longer subjects of a lesson; they become owners of their journey.

💡 Practical implication: Educational designs should offer choice, personalize feedback, and encourage learners to set their own goals and pace.

How Memory Works: Why Discovery Outlasts Instruction

Our brains are not tape recorders—they are active constructors of knowledge. When we simply hear or read information, it passes through short-term memory, often lost within hours or days unless effortfully retained.

However, when a learner discovers knowledge—through experimentation, problem-solving, questioning, or reflection—it activates deeper cognitive networks.

Key differences:

  • Instruction delivers ready-made answers → fleeting memory
  • Discovery requires mental effort → deeper encoding and longer retention

This aligns with what psychologists call the “generation effect”: people remember information better when they generate it themselves rather than receive it passively.

Cognitive Science Insights That Support Self-Learning

Let’s dive into three powerful, science-backed tools that naturally emerge in self-directed learning environments:

1. Active Recall

Retrieving knowledge strengthens memory far more than re-reading or listening.
Example: Learners quizzing themselves or explaining a concept aloud retain it longer.

2. Spaced Repetition

Spacing out review sessions over days/weeks helps commit knowledge to long-term memory.
Example: Digital flashcard apps like Anki use this principle to help students master complex topics.

3. Constructivist Learning Theory

Constructivism, championed by thinkers like Jean Piaget and Lev Vygotsky, suggests that learners construct new understanding by building on what they already know.
Example: When learners tackle real-world problems using prior knowledge, they deepen understanding through application and synthesis.

💡 Practical implication: Design learning experiences around exploration, projects, and reflection—not lectures.

4.1. Blended Learning: Bridging Digital and Physical

Blended learning is not just a delivery method—it is a philosophical pivot that redefines how, when, and where learning happens. At its core, it empowers learners by combining digital autonomy with human connection, creating an environment where self-paced discovery meets real-world engagement.

This model dismantles the walls of the traditional classroom while preserving what makes human learning powerful: mentorship, feedback, and collaboration.

Definition and Essence

Blended Learning integrates:

  • Asynchronous, self-paced digital content (videos, quizzes, simulations, forums)
    with
  • Synchronous, live interaction and mentorship (in-person or virtual guidance, group reflection, hands-on practice)

Unlike fully online or fully traditional models, blended learning optimizes both worlds:

  • Learners consume foundational knowledge at their own pace.
  • Live sessions are used for higher-order tasks—discussion, critique, co-creation.

The result is active engagement, not passive attendance.

Popular Models of Blended Learning

Here are three field-tested structures within the blended framework:

1. Flipped Classroom

  • Learners watch video lessons or study materials before class.
  • In-class time is used for application, debate, and problem-solving.

💡 Best for: Subjects requiring conceptual clarity and discussion (math, science, history, ethics)

2. Station Rotation

  • Learners rotate between different learning stations:
    • Digital content
    • Peer collaboration
    • Teacher coaching

💡 Best for: Schools or NGOs with varied learner needs, especially in resource-limited environments.

3. Flex Learning

  • Core content is delivered online; physical presence is optional and tailored.
  • Learners have control over time, path, and pace.

💡 Best for: Adult learners, workforce reskilling, rural or remote training programs.

Hidden Pitfalls of Group Learning: When Collaboration Goes Wrong

While group learning offers great benefits, it comes with several hidden pitfalls that can hinder true learning.

1. Diffusion of Responsibility

In group settings, individuals may feel less responsible for the outcome, believing that others will pick up the slack. This lack of accountability can lead to poor participation and reduced individual effort.

Example: In group projects, one person often ends up doing the lion’s share of the work, while others coast along.

How to Prevent It:

  • Clearly define roles and responsibilities at the start.
  • Use individual contributions assessments and self-reflection logs to ensure accountability.

2. Herd Mentality

Groupthink occurs when the desire for harmony or conformity within the group leads to poor decisions or a lack of critical thinking. Group members might silence dissenting opinions to avoid conflict or seek approval.

Example: In a meeting, everyone agrees on an idea just to avoid disagreement, even though there are valid concerns.

How to Prevent It:

  • Actively encourage contrarian perspectives.
  • Use structured debates and encourage healthy dissent.
  • Rotate leadership roles so everyone has a chance to guide the group.

3. Social Loafing

In larger groups, some individuals may become passive, relying on others to do the work or make decisions. This phenomenon, known as social loafing, stifles engagement and dilutes the quality of learning.

Example: In team-based learning settings, some students may disengage, waiting for others to initiate discussion or contribute insights.

How to Prevent It:

  • Set clear goals for each group member.
  • Use peer evaluations to hold individuals accountable for their contributions.
  • Implement time-bound tasks to prevent procrastination and disengagement.

When to Use Solo Learning vs. When to Enable Peer Scaffolding

The decision between solo learning and group learning is not one-size-fits-all. Here’s a guide to knowing when to use each:

Solo Learning is best when:

  • Deep mastery is required: Solo learning is ideal when a learner needs time and space to work through complex material at their own pace (e.g., learning to code, mastering mathematics, writing a thesis).
  • Self-reflection and critical thinking are key: When a learner must understand their own thought process, individual work is vital. This is particularly true for metacognitive growth and self-directed learning.
  • Personalized feedback is essential: When learners need focused, individualized feedback, it’s best provided in a one-on-one setting with a coach or mentor.

Group Learning is best when:

  • Ideas need to be synthesized: When diverse perspectives are essential to solve problems, group learning is critical. This is where the power of brainstorming and problem-solving shines.
  • Social interaction enhances learning: Collaboration and communication skills are essential in many fields. Group projects, discussions, or workshops can help develop these skills.
  • Learning needs to be contextualized: Group learning allows learners to explore real-world applications and test ideas in dynamic environments.

Blending the Two: Hybrid Learning Models

The future of education doesn’t require choosing one over the other but blending the best of both. Hybrid models can combine solo and group work to maximize both individual ownership and collaborative development.

Example: “Learn Alone, Apply Together”

  • Solo Learning Phase: The learner goes through theory-heavy content at their own pace (e.g., watching a series of instructional videos on a subject like financial planning).
  • Group Application Phase: The learner then applies their knowledge in a real-world group setting—perhaps collaborating on a project, problem-solving with peers, or discussing practical applications.

Example: In a business course, learners first individually study marketing concepts via e-learning modules. Then, in a group, they create a marketing plan for a hypothetical company. This applies the learned concepts while encouraging peer feedback and critical thinking.
